
OnePlus Mini Prototype (non final name & specifications!)
Mediatek Helio X10 (MT6795T)
MT6630 ac Wi-Fi, BT4.1, FM Radio, GNSS
2GB Dual-Channel LPDDR3 Ram
32GB eMMC 5.0 Storage + microSDXC
LTE Cat.4, two nano SIM slots (Dual-SIM)
13MP Sony IMX258 Rear Camera with PDAF, f/2.0, Dual-Tone LED Flash
4K 30fps Video recording (HEVC Encoding)
5MP Wide-Angle OV Front Camera (1080p Video)
Rear Fingerprint Sensor, NFC with support for Android Pay(!), IR Blaster on top
5″ FullHD IPS Display with PSR & CABC (see notes for explanation)
2.5D Gorilla Glass, Water-repellant Anti-Fingerprint Coating
3000-3100mA/h non-removable Lithium-Polymer Battery
Qualcomm SMB1357 QC2.0 Power Management Unit
USB Type-C (USB 2.0) with 18W Quick Charge 2.0
MT3188 Wireless Charging (qi/pma/A4WP), 5W max.
Removable Plastic Shell, IP67 Dust- & Water-Resistance
1.2W Front facing stereo speakers
~250$ Price-Tag, November-December launch (?)
Side-Notes:
1. I think it’s using the same camera & display as the Xiaomi Mi4c
2. The Display uses PSR (=Panel Self Refresh, OnePlus calls it DRAM=Display Ram)
3. The Display uses CABC (=Content Aware Backlight Control, Mediatek calls it “Smart Screen”)
4. The Camera may or may not feature Mediatek’s Super Slow Motion (1080p at 480fps)
5. Definitely no weird dual-camera setup (as some “leaks” suggested)
6. Not sure if Gorilla Glass 3 or 4, but it’s 2.5D & nano-coated (oleophobic + hydrophobic)
7. A lot of plastic shells will be sold seperately (different styles & colors)
8. The Mini will compete directly with the Xiaomi Mi4C & the Moto G 2015
9. There will be kernel source code and thus custom rom & kernel developement
10. Because the Helio X10’s GPU is not all that powerful, demanding 3D games can be rendered at a lower resolution (720p instead of 1080p). Mediatek’s MiraVision technology will then upscale it back to 1080p (= no noticeable drop in sharpness), improving FPS performance while also reducing power consumption & heat output
